Will CIU Grant Credit for Military Training?

YES Credit for Military Training

CIU might grant college credit to those who have completed specialized military training. Talk with your admissions counselor to learn more. Earning credit for what you already know can save you time and money toward a degree. Beyond military training, ask CIU whether it awards credit for life or work experience, CLEP exams, or other prior learning.

CIU Reserve Officer Training Corps (ROTC)

Reserve Officer Training Corps (ROTC) programs are not available at CIU.

Complaints to the VA About CIU

There have been no complaints registered to the VA for this college.
